What is NYC ZR § 54-31?

Quick Answer

This section outlines the conditions under which a non-complying building or structure may be enlarged or converted, emphasizing that such actions must not create new non-compliance or increase existing non-compliance. The statute applies to building owners seeking to modify their properties while adhering to bulk regulations.

§ 54-31 General Provisions

ZR § 54-31

Except as otherwise provided in this Chapter, a non-complying building or other structure may be enlarged or converted, provided that no enlargement or conversion may be made which would either create a new non-compliance or increase the degree of non-compliance of a building or other structure or any portion thereof. A building that is complying with the applicable bulk regulations may be enlarged or converted, provided that no enlargement or conversion may be made that would create a new non-compliance, except as set forth in Section 54-50 (MODIFICATIONS TO THE PROVISIONS OF THIS CHAPTER), inclusive.
